How much do live in commissions analyst jobs pay per hour?

As of Jun 6, 2026, the average hourly pay for live in commissions analyst in the United States is $35.97,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$25.24 and $42.07 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

Job description

POSITION SUMMARY:
The Senior Commissions Analyst, Sales is responsible for ensuring the timely and accurate calculation of commissions in Xactly. Support the Sales organization by providing timely, accurate, and insightful business expense performance analyses to management. Gathers analyzes, prepares, and summarizes recommendations for financial plans, future requirements, and operating forecasts.
PRIMARY RESPONSIBILITIES:
  • Configuring and managing new compensation plan implementations and changes on Xactly. Handle administrative operations including employee set-up, access management, maintaining hierarchies, and streamlining workflows.
  • Responsible for all aspects of day to day commission administration in Xactly Incent resulting in accurate and timely commission payments to meet Payroll deadlines.
  • Troubleshoot and resolve data discrepancies or exceptions within Xactly Incent and effectively communicate outcomes. Submit final payments to payroll and 3rd party vendors to meet payroll deadlines
  • Preparation of commission approval documents, detailed backup, and conducting commission approval meetings for SOX compliance.
  • Provide monthly accruals for sales commission and partner with Accounting team ensure these are appropriately are booked Work with sales management to develop monthly forecasts and annual budgets on sales expenses.
  • Provide monthly accruals for sales commission and partner with Accounting team ensure these are appropriately are booked
  • This role works with PHI on a regular basis both in paper and electronic form and have access to various technologies to access PHI (paper and electronic) to perform the job.
  • Employee must complete training relating to HIPAA/PHI privacy, General Policies and Procedure Compliance training, and security training as soon as possible but not later than the first 30 days of hire. Employee must pass a post-offer criminal background check.

QUALIFICATIONS:
  • Bachelor's degree in a field such as Finance, Economics, or related field
  • At least 3 years of relevant experience supporting a sales organization or other dynamically incentivized organization Previous experience with Xactly
  • Advanced proficiency in Excel

KNOWLEDGE, SKILLS, AND ABILITIES:
  • Exceptional quantitative and MS Excel skills
  • Self-motivation, with the desire and capacity to work both independently and collaboratively
  • Extreme attention to detail
  • Endless curiosity and a need to dive deeper for understanding

Natera™ is a global leader in cell-free DNA (cfDNA) testing, dedicated to oncology, women's health, and organ health. Our aim is to make personalized genetic testing and diagnostics part of the standard of care to protect health and enable earlier and more targeted interventions that lead to longer, healthier lives.
The Natera team consists of highly dedicated statisticians, geneticists, doctors, laboratory scientists, business professionals, software engineers and many other professionals from world-class institutions, who care deeply for our work and each other.
